
Dechaine, Ross James CD – 60 of Grand Lake, NS, passed away peacefully July 30th, 2013, at the QEII Centennial Building with my family at my side. Born in Regina, Saskatchewan, I was the eldest son of the late John and Lynette (Lovering) Dechaine of Stoughton Saskatchewan. At an early age I entered the military and I had a very successful career in the Canadian Armed Forces, serving for twenty years with postings in Manitoba (Portage La Prairie, Winnipeg), Nova Scotia (HMCS Iroquois) Europe (Lahr, West Germany) and Alberta (Edmonton). After all that movement, I decided to follow my wife’s wishes to retire and reside in her beloved province of Nova Scotia. My retirement was short lived, as I became an employee with Canada Post Corporation and worked for this organization until my official retirement in September 2012. I leave behind my lovely wife of thirty four years, Mary Alice (Robbins) Dechaine; sisters Judy (Garth Graham) Stoughton, Saskatchewan, Doris (Kent Bilokreli) Yorkton, Saskatchewan; brother John (Jocelyn) Dechaine, Gimli, Manitoba; sister-in-law Margaret (Angus Weeks) Wilmot, Nova Scotia as well as their families. By my wishes, there will be no memorial service and I will be cremated with a private interment held at a later date in Saskatchewan. In lieu of flowers and donations, I wish everyone to make every effort to enjoy your life, your friendships, and the most precious of all possessions – Your Family.
